- In this role, you will:
- Conduct detailed work with lockout, tagout (LOTO) software including the drafting of lockouts/tagouts required to make systems safe in support of Production and Commissioning activities.
- Draft test documentation and work instructions.
- Track and monitor entry safety boards.
- Act as primary Point of Contact to personnel accessing the Submarine for LOTO applicable to work orders and work instructions.
- Coordinate resources and supporting services for the testing, acceptance and maintenance activities of Victoria Class Submarine (VCS) communication systems and equipment.
- Act as a Test Director and lead a multi-disciplinary team during the testing of submarine systems and equipment.
- Identify risks and opportunities during testing and maintenance.
- Conduct equipment troubleshooting, fault diagnosis and corrective maintenance.
- Contribute to the determination of solutions to problems and issues of moderate to high complexity and clearly articulate complex technical issues, solutions and risks to all stakeholders (technical and non-technical).
- Work effectively as part of a broader technical team and lead small to medium sized teams to deliver assigned projects or tasks.
- Be responsive to Managers for dynamic program delivery requirements in a shipyard waterfront environment.
- Other duties as required.
- Post-secondary education in an engineering discipline or equivalent training and experience.
- 4+ years of relevant experience.
- Experience in operating and troubleshooting information technology, communication equipment and related equipment.
- Experience with using VCS Communication equipment, an asset.
- Experience working with Royal Canadian Navy (RCN) personnel and coordinating communication trials, an asset.
- Strong communication skills; written, verbal and interpersonal.
- Marine, offshore oil and gas drilling or naval vessel experience, an asset.
- New construction commissioning or retro-commissioning, an asset.
- Have the physical ability to walk and/or stand for extended periods.
- Have the physical dexterity to allow for working in confined spaces and areas with limited room for movement.
- Is comfortable working on scaffolding at heights and around water.
